1. Workbench

A sturdy and well-built workbench is the heart of any woodworking workspace. It provides a stable platform to work on and holds your materials securely. Look for a workbench that is not only spacious but also has built-in clamps and vices to hold your projects in place. A solid workbench will make your woodworking tasks easier and more efficient.

4. Clamps and Vises

Clamps and vises are essential for holding pieces of wood securely in place during the woodworking process. They ensure stability and accuracy in your work. It is recommended to have a variety of clamps, including bar clamps, pipe clamps, and quick-release clamps, in your man cave to accommodate different project sizes and shapes.
